Understanding the Battery System of the Potensic D80

The Potensic D80 uses high-capacity lithium-polymer (LiPo) batteries designed to deliver powerful, sustained energy for extended flights. These batteries are sensitive to charging practices and environmental conditions. Proper handling and maintenance can significantly extend their lifespan and ensure safe operation.

Battery Charging Tips

  • Use the recommended charger: Always charge the batteries with the charger provided by Potensic or one that matches the specifications. Using incompatible chargers can damage the battery or pose safety risks.
  • Charge in a safe environment: Charge batteries on a non-flammable surface, away from direct sunlight and moisture.
  • Monitor the charging process: Never leave batteries unattended while charging. Use a fireproof charging bag if possible.
  • Charge to the recommended voltage: Do not overcharge or undercharge. Most LiPo batteries should be charged to 4.2V per cell.
  • Balance charging: Always use a balance charger to ensure each cell is charged evenly, which helps prevent capacity loss and swelling.

Power Management During Flights

Effective power management during flight can maximize your drone’s operational time and maintain safety. Here are some practical tips:

  • Pre-flight check: Ensure batteries are fully charged before each flight. Check for any signs of swelling or damage.
  • Monitor battery levels: Keep an eye on the battery indicator during flight. Land immediately if voltage drops below safe levels.
  • Optimize flight plans: Plan your routes to minimize unnecessary maneuvers and conserve battery life.
  • Avoid extreme temperatures: Cold weather can reduce battery capacity, while excessive heat can cause swelling. Store batteries in a cool, dry place.
  • Use power-saving modes: If available, enable any power-saving features to extend flight time.

Post-flight Battery Care

Proper post-flight care can help maintain battery health:

  • Discharge batteries if storing: If you won’t fly for an extended period, discharge the batteries to about 50% before storage.
  • Store in a safe place: Keep batteries in a cool, dry, and fireproof container away from flammable materials.
  • Regular inspection: Check batteries periodically for swelling, corrosion, or damage.
  • Avoid full discharge: Do not fully deplete LiPo batteries, as this can damage their capacity.

Safety Precautions

Always prioritize safety when handling drone batteries:

  • Keep away from water: LiPo batteries are sensitive to moisture and can catch fire if damaged or mishandled.
  • Avoid punctures: Do not puncture or crush the batteries.
  • Dispose properly: Follow local regulations for battery disposal or recycling.
  • Use protective gear: Wear safety goggles and gloves when handling damaged batteries.
